PM Modi breaks protocol, receives Qatar Emir at Delhi airport

NEW DELHI: Qatar Emir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al-Thani arrived in Delhi on a two-day visit to India. Prime Minister Narendra Modi, after setting aside protocol, received him at the New Delhi airport in the evening.

The Emir will be accorded a ceremonial welcome at Rashtrapati Bhavan this morning. He will then meet the Prime Minister at Hyderabad House. MoUs will be signed. The Emir will also meet President Draupadi Murmu. A high-level delegation including ministers, senior officials, and business leaders is also accompanying the Emir. This is the second visit of the Qatar Emir to India. He had visited India in March 2015.

"Went to the airport to welcome my brother, Amir of Qatar H.H. Sheikh Tamim Bin Hamad Al Thani. Wishing him a fruitful stay in India and looking forward to our meeting tomorrow."

- Prime Minister Narendra Modi (Posted in X)
